ZHANG DAQIAN (1899-1983)
Mushroom Bundle
Scroll, mounted and framed, ink on paper
118 x 53 cm. (46 12 x 20 78 in.)
Inscribed and signed, with two seals of the artist
Dated fourteenth day, seventh month, wuzi year (1948)
Dedicated to Jiade (Zhang Xinjia)

NOTE: According to the inscription, Zhang Daqian painted the present painting in Zhaojue Temple in Chengdu, Sichuan Province, after the rain. The artist resided in the Buddhist temple for an extended period of time after he returned from Dunhuang. The mushrooms were especially painted for his niece Xinjia.
